Northwest Calgary: Where Urban Sophistication Meets Nature's Majesty

Nestled against the stunning backdrop of the Rocky Mountains, Northwest Calgary offers a delightful blend of urban sophistication and natural beauty. Home to the prestigious University of Calgary, this vibrant district thrives with youthful energy, cultural venues, and lush urban parks. Explore the serene pathways of Nose Hill Park, where panoramic views await, or cheer on your favourite team at McMahon Stadium. With its eclectic dining scene and proximity to the picturesque Bow River, Northwest Calgary is an ideal destination for those seeking adventure, culture, and a touch of luxury in the heart of Alberta.

Best time to go to Northwest Calgary

Northwest Calgary has a varied climate due to its size, so the best time to visit depends on the region and your preferences for weather and crowds. The peak travel months to visit Northwest Calgary are June to August,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by no r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
